All three support hot-reloading of configuration — the watcher process detects changes to the mounted config map and applies them within roughly ten seconds, without a pod restart. Reviewers should note that only keys under the `runtime` namespace are hot-reloadable; anything else still requires a rolling deploy, and PRs that assume otherwise get bounced. Reload events are logged with the old and new values for auditability. Staging currently runs with the following configuration.

config for kafof-bawef:
holath:
  log_level: debug
  metrics_host: metrics.holath.qorvelsys.internal
  pin: 2191
  pool_size: 32

Handover for the eng sync: fan-out backpressure on NotiFount is mostly tamed. Added per-channel token buckets last sprint; queue depth now stays under 2k during peak. Remaining issue: the webhook lane still spikes when a big tenant bulk-sends. Mitigation flag exists but isn't automated yet. Details and graphs are here.

dashboard of yafog-fajof = https://jira.tolvaqsys.internal/pages/pages/projects/49fe21c4

**14:22 — Stale cache identified.** The Quillbox pricing page was serving week-old values because the invalidation queue on the Fennmore cluster had silently stalled. New team members: this is why we now alert on queue lag, not just queue errors. The fix deployed at 14:40 carried the build token recorded below.

build token for kagaf-hahof: htk14_9d3d4d26d7d8de